FlowState Trading Journal is an offline Windows desktop app for traders who want to review execution quality, R-multiple performance, psychology, mistakes, and consistency without using a cloud-based platform. You can log open and closed trades, track R-multiple, review emotions, tag recurring mistakes, calculate position size, import/export CSV files, and back up your journal locally. No login. No broker API. No cloud sync. Your trading journal stays on your own Windows device.

Hey Product Hunt, I built FlowState Trading Journal as a lightweight offline desktop journal for traders who want to review their execution more honestly. Most trading tools focus on signals, entries, alerts, or automation. This one is different. It is built for what happens after the trade: reviewing the plan, the mistake, the emotion, the R-multiple, and whether the trade actually followed the original idea. The app is fully offline. There is no login, no broker API, no cloud sync, and no live trading connection. It is not a bot and it does not give financial advice. The goal is simple: help traders build a cleaner review habit and see which mistakes keep repeating. A “hunter” on Product Hunt is the community member who submits a product to the platform — uploading the images, the link, and tagging the makers behind it. Hunters typically write the first comment explaining why a product is worth attention, and their followers are notified the moment they post. Around 79% of featured launches on Product Hunt are self-hunted by their makers, but a well-known hunter still acts as a signal of quality to the rest of the community.
